At least 10 years in the making and after three years of construction, Chanel’s stunning new Beverly Hills flagship has opened at 400 N. Clocking in at 30,000 square feet, it’s now the biggest Chanel store in the United States and more than double the size of its previous Rodeo Drive space.

The store is a refined art piece in its own right — a pure, cool, cube outside and a warm light-filled oasis inside. It took a lot of time and money to carve out this much space on Rodeo. According to WWD, Chanel first bought the former Lladro building in 2013 for $100 million, then two years later paid $152 million for its own building, which it had been renting, in order to combine the two lots.

The partners also hold development rights for another 2 million square feet in the neighborhood, where they can build hotels, offices and residential projects. In addition to Gucci, the high-end retail district is home to Hermès, Louis Vuitton, Fendi, Dior, Cartier, Saint Laurent, Prada, Celine, Bottega Veneta and other luxury brands. The Design District has long pursued Chanel, which has since 1994 had a store at Bal Harbour Shops, owned by rival Whitman Family Development. Touring a group of us through some of the fair’s more exciting minimalist holdings, Zoldan highlighted several pieces expected to fetch tidy sums—among them, an untitled work by Claudio Parmiggiani shown by Simon Lee Gallery. A member of Italy’s Arte Povera movement, Parmiggiani created the cinder-coated panel this year by capturing residual soot from a bonfire in his studio. The result is a ghostly, poetic image that speaks to themes of memory, time, and destruction.
